Commercial Interior Design That Reduces Waiting Stress
Waiting areas are where anxiety builds. Design can help manage that.
Commercial interior design focuses on spacing, acoustics, and visual comfort. Seating should be arranged to provide personal space while still supporting efficient use of the area.
Interior design services often include sound control strategies such as acoustic panels or soft finishes to reduce noise. This creates a quieter and more controlled environment.
The office design layout should also limit direct views into treatment areas. This helps reduce stress for patients waiting for procedures.
Office furniture design supports this by offering comfortable, easy-to-clean seating and integrated charging or storage where needed.
Canadian office furniture manufacturers provide options that balance durability with a clean, professional look.
A calm waiting area sets the tone for the entire visit.

Office Interior Design That Improves Consultations
Consultation spaces influence decision-making. Patients need to feel comfortable, informed, and respected.
Office interior design for these rooms should focus on clarity and communication. Seating arrangements that allow direct eye contact help build trust.
Commercial interior design often includes integrated screens or display areas to review treatment plans clearly.
Interior design services also ensure lighting is balanced. Spaces should feel calm but not dim, allowing for clear discussion.
The office design layout should position consultation rooms close to treatment areas to maintain a smooth patient journey.
Office furniture design should support both comfort and functionality, with tables, chairs, and storage that keep the space organized.
Canadian office furniture systems can integrate technology without creating visual clutter.
A well-designed consultation room helps patients feel confident in their decisions.
